This is their new midengine supercar that replaces the 488/F8 (which was quite lovely). It's awkward from every angle- especially the rear. Here is its predecessor for comparison:
Ferrari-f8-aerial-side.jpg



However, this will be the most powerful Ferrari ever- even more power than the 950hp hypercar LaFerrari. And as regular production model, it will cost much less. Also their first midengine car with AWD- with electric motors powering the front wheels to an astonishing 2.5 seconds to 60.
